Zygaena carniolica (Scopoli, 1763)

In Belgium, this very rare species is only known from some localities in two southern provinces. Populations can fluctuate considerably from year to year.

The larva lives on Anthyllis, Dorycnium, Lotus or Onobrychis.

The adults fly in July and August. They are active during the day. This species is noted for its late afternoon aggregations.
